Merchant support
Chat, call, or submit a support case
Sign in to your account and use our online chat or submit an online support case. You can also reach us by phone at 1-877-447-3938.
Merchant support
US: 877-447-3938
UK/Europe: +44 (0) 203 564 4844
AUS: +61 1800 019 932
Support Hours: 24x7
(Closed major holidays)
Partner support
US: 888-437-0481
UK/Europe: +44 (0) 203 564 5370
Support Hours: 24x7
(Closed major holidays)
Affiliate support
US: 866-682-4131
UK/Europe: +44 (0) 203 564 5370
Support Hours: 24x7
(Closed major holidays)